Zero Touch Deployment
New, factory fresh LM Series appliances can use DHCP and/or DNS to automatically find and register themselves with the Lantronix Control Center (LCC), allowing network engineers to easily provision them via the LCC, eliminating the need to stage configurations or send technical personal to remote sites for deployment purposes.
Automatic Configuration of NTP and DNS Servers via DHCP
Primary and secondary NTP and DNS servers are automatically set per those delivered in a DHCP Offer if NTP and DNS servers are not already configured. Any NTP and DNS servers configured via the CLI or the UCC will override server information delivered via DHCP.
Automatically Detect and Configure Internal Modems
An internal modem is automatically detected and configured if one is present - this includes setting the modem make, model and serial bit rate for all internal modems. PPP settings will be automatically configured for the case of a cellular modem.
